About the job
We are looking for an experienced Truck Driver to serve our supply chain organization department in a safe and timely manner. Route driving delivery cannabis products to our retail locations and third-party retailers that carry our products. Cannabis Industry experience is a plus!
Key Responsibilities
- Will be driving all box truck types up to 26 ft.
- Pick-up, load, and transport finished products directly to the customer
- Follow routes and time schedules
- Package product and operate your delivery vehicle
- Receive feedback on provided services and resolve clients’ complaints
- Collect payments, handle cash and change
- Complete logs and reports
- Inspect vehicles for mechanical items and safety issues and perform preventative maintenance
- Comply with truck driving rules and regulations (size, weight, route designations, parking, and break periods) as well as with company policies and procedures
- Assist with store delivery and pick up, loading and unloading, removing dunnage and pallets
- Maneuver trucks into loading and unloading positions
- Collect and verify delivery instructions
- Report defects, accidents, or violations
